Features and specs

What each product offers, as listed by its team.

Fireflies.ai 5 features
The Algorithm 0 features
  • Automated Note-Taking
    Fireflies.ai automatically transcribes meetings in real-time, which saves time and ensures accuracy in capturing all important points discussed during the meeting.
  • Searchable Transcripts
    The platform provides searchable transcripts, enabling users to quickly find specific information or action items discussed without having to listen to the entire meeting.
  • Integrations
    Fireflies.ai integrates with popular conferencing tools like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, and Google Meet, as well as project management tools like Slack and Asana, enhancing overall workflow and productivity.
  • Collaboration Features
    Team members can highlight, comment, and collaborate on the meeting notes and transcripts, facilitating better team alignment and follow-up actions.
  • Voice Commands
    The AI can recognize voice commands for tasks like setting reminders and creating tasks, adding an extra layer of convenience for meeting participants.

Possible disadvantages

  • Accuracy of Transcription
    While generally accurate, the AI transcription is not perfect and may misinterpret names, jargon, or accents, which could require manual correction.
  • Data Security
    As with any platform that records and stores potentially sensitive meeting information, there are concerns about data security and privacy, which may be critical for some organizations.
  • Cost
    Fireflies.ai offers a range of pricing plans, and some advanced features are only available in the higher-tier plans, which could be a cost concern for small businesses or start-ups.
  • Dependence on Internet
    The service relies heavily on a strong internet connection for real-time transcription, which might be problematic in areas with poor connectivity.
  • Potential Technical Issues
    Users may experience occasional technical issues, such as difficulties in integrating the tool with certain platforms or glitches during transcription, which could disrupt workflow.

Overall verdict

  • Fireflies.ai is generally well-received for its accurate transcription capabilities and seamless integration with tools like Zoom, Google Meet, and Slack. It offers valuable features, especially for teams looking for efficient ways to manage meeting content. However, its effectiveness can vary based on the audio quality and complexity of the meeting.

Why this product is good

  • Fireflies.ai is a popular AI-driven meeting assistant that automates the process of recording, transcribing, and organizing meetings. It helps users save time and enhances productivity by allowing easy playback and analysis of meeting content.

Recommended for

  • Teams that frequently conduct online meetings
  • Professionals looking to save time on note-taking
  • Industries where accurate records of meetings are crucial
  • Users who need seamless integration with other productivity tools
